Goal

This document defines the location of the utility for upgrading the Sun Storage 2500 series arrays from 06.x to 07.x firmware, along with the documentation for that process.

To upgrade firmware from 06.x to 07.x on the Sun Storage 6000 series, please refer to <Document 1131593.1> Procedure to Upgrade the Sun StorageTek[TM] 6540 Array, 6140 Array or FLX380 Storage Array from Firmware 06.xx to 07.xx.

Solution

You first need to download and read carefully the procedure in the Sun StorageTek 2500 Series Array Firmware Upgrade Guide document.

Then you need to download the Sun StorageTek 25xx Series Firmware Upgrade Utility and proceed with the instructions in the upgrade guide.

The above Sun StorageTek 25xx Series Firmware Upgrade Utility includes all supported bundles for platforms that the utility may be installed upon.
